What you cannot do with this platform
This list is not exhaustive, but it is concrete. If something resembles it, do not do it.
- Impersonate a brand, a bank, a public administration or another person.
- Send unsolicited bulk messages over any channel.
- Collect personal data by deception, including credentials and payment details.
- Publish or distribute illegal content, or material that exploits minors.
- Harass, threaten or incite hatred or violence.
- Automate decisions with legal effects on a person without human supervision.
- Use the platform to attack third-party systems or bypass their security measures.
Custom domains
Before enabling a custom domain we verify the organization legal identity and review whether the requested name resembles a known brand. A domain imitating a bank, a telecom or a public body is not activated.
What happens on breach
We warn, suspend or cancel, in that order and according to severity. In cases of active fraud or risk to third parties, suspension is immediate.
Every measure is communicated to the organization owner with its reason, and recorded in a log that cannot be edited.
How to report
Anyone can report abuse from the public form, without an account. A person reviews it.
